Interim Standards

On April 16, 2003, the Board adopted certain pre-existing standards as its interim standards to be used on an initial, transitional basis. PCAOB Rules 3200T, 3300T, 3400T, 3500T, and 3600T describe the standards that the Board adopted and require registered public accounting firms and their associated persons to comply with these interim standards to the extent not superseded or amended by the Board.

To the extent a PCAOB standard addresses a subject matter that also is addressed in the interim standards, the affected portion of the interim standard should be considered superseded or effectively amended. The Board also has made certain conforming amendments to the interim standards to reflect the effect of the adoption of PCAOB standards. In applying the interim standards, it remains the responsibility of the registered public accounting firm and its associated persons (and anyone else using the interim standards) to determine whether a particular interim standard has been superseded or amended by the Board, whether that has been reflected as a conforming amendment or not.

In the event of typographical or other technical errors in the electronic version of the interim standards, the interim standards that the Board adopted pursuant to the relevant rule (e.g., generally accepted auditing standards as described in SAS No. 95, as in existence on April 16, 2003, to the extent not superseded or amended by the Board) govern. The electronic version of the interim standards may be updated from time to time to correct typographical or other technical errors.

Interim Auditing Standards (more)

Pursuant to Rule 3200T, Interim Auditing Standards consist of generally accepted auditing standards, as described in the AICPA’s Auditing Standards Board’s Statement of Auditing Standards No. 95, and related interpretations, as in existence on April 16, 2003, to the extent not superseded or amended by the Board.

Interim Attestation Standards (more)

Pursuant to Rule 3300T, Interim Attestation Standards consist of the AICPA’s Auditing Standards Board’s Statements on Standards for Attestation Engagements, and related interpretations, as in existence on April 16, 2003, to the extent not superseded or amended by the Board.

Interim Quality Control Standards (more)

Pursuant to Rule 3400T, Interim Quality Control Standards consist of the AICPA’s Auditing Standards Board’s Statements on Quality Control Standards, as in existence on April 16, 2003, to the extent not superseded or amended by the Board, and (for those firms that were members of the AICPA SEC Practice Section) certain AICPA SEC Practice Section’s membership requirements, as in existence on April 16, 2003, to the extent not superseded or amended by the Board.

Interim Ethics Standards (more)

Pursuant to Rule 3500T, Interim Ethics Standards consist of ethics standards described in the AICPA’s Code of Professional Conduct Rule 102, and interpretations and rulings thereunder, as in existence on April 16, 2003, to the extent not superseded or amended by the Board.

Interim Independence Standards (more)

Pursuant to Rule 3600T, Interim Independence Standards consist of independence standards described in the AICPA’s Code of Professional Conduct Rule 101, and interpretations and rulings thereunder, as in existence on April 16, 2003, to the extent not superseded or amended by the Board, and Standards Nos. 1, 2, and 3, and Interpretations 99-1, 00-1, and 00-2, of the Independence Standards Board, to the extent not superseded or amended by the Board.
